What type of ship is this?

AFRICAN JACANA (IMO 9638824) is a Dry bulk/Supramax ship built in 2012 and is sailing under the flag of Panama. She has an overall length (LOA) of 197 meters and a width (beam) of 32 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 58,753 tonnes.
